Over the past decade, the landscape of casual and arcade gaming has undergone a transformative shift, primarily driven by the proliferation of smartphones and advances in mobile technology. As industry analysts note, mobile gaming revenue surpassed $100 billion globally in 2023, accounting for nearly 50% of the total gaming market, reflecting its central role in contemporary entertainment. A key component of this trend is the resurgence of simple, addictive game formats that mimic classic arcade experiences, now accessible through increasingly sophisticated mobile apps.

Reconnecting with the Classics: The Appeal of Digital Arcade Games

Traditional arcade games of the 1980s and 1990s, such as Pac-Man and Shooter, laid the groundwork for the engaging mechanics that continue to resonate with players. Today’s developers leverage nostalgia, combined with modern gameplay and social features, to create compelling mobile experiences. According to industry data, approximately 65% of mobile gamers aged 18-34 report feeling nostalgic when engaging with arcade-style titles, indicating a strong emotional connection that fuels user retention.

Technological Innovations Enabling New Gameplay Paradigms

Recent advances, particularly in touch-screen technology, haptic feedback, and cloud computing, have enhanced the performance and fidelity of arcade-inspired games. Moreover, the integration of social leaderboards, in-game rewards, and multiplayer modes increases engagement and encourages repeated play. This convergence of nostalgia and innovation exemplifies how developers craft captivating experiences that appeal across generations.
